Output ecb8d948fc5fc053f3d17c5946e7cf9e3770eaedfc3cdc91d403d66599e0a2e2:1

value
20035250
script pubkey
OP_0 OP_PUSHBYTES_20 86d30d77e0d43a83a2319e2b5b1ce1f4562276ff
address
bc1qsmfs6alq6sag8g33nc44k88p73tzyahl00awrr
transaction
ecb8d948fc5fc053f3d17c5946e7cf9e3770eaedfc3cdc91d403d66599e0a2e2
confirmations
247276
spent
true